The corporation was formed in the 46th year of Showa, which means the 46 year of the reign of Emperor Hirohito. That was in 1971. The date was 2-13-46.
Each share of stock in the company has a stated value of 500 ¥ . Initially, 16,000 shares were issued, which means that the company had a value of 8 million yen. This is about $80,000 at the present rate of exchange, but at that time the yen was worth much less.
Ishi Press is a Kabushiki Kaisha, which means that it is a corporation which can do everything. I am the Daihyo Torishimari Yaku, which means that I am the director who represents the company. This document itself is called a Tokiboto, which means Company Registration Document.
